Output 658af645b079edf03ed2cf95ff4dafc6fae754690220dc9d3a23c0c8dc65119e:0

value
89289
script pubkey
OP_0 OP_PUSHBYTES_20 27b8142d9fec4efaf8b2a18e184fb870e120d22e
address
tb1qy7upgtvla380479j5x8psnacwrsjp53we9y579
transaction
658af645b079edf03ed2cf95ff4dafc6fae754690220dc9d3a23c0c8dc65119e